Political firebrand, bete noir of the right-wing tabloids and thorn in the side of New Labour, George Galloway is one of the most iconoclastic figures in public life today.

Hes been threatened, smeared and branded a traitor for his stand against the war in Iraq, yet refuses to be gagged and remains a fearless activist for peace and social justice worldwide.

In Im Not the Only One he continues his campaign, speaking out for the millions of citizens who feel powerless and disenfranchised in todays political vacuum.

In the era of Tory Blair and a New Labour thats betrayed its socialist roots, attacked civil liberties and swallowed the corporate lie, its time, he argues, for an alternative.

Here Galloway outlines his compelling vision of a new political movement: a coalition that speaks for all those people ? whether Muslim or Christian, black or white, pensioner or student ? locked out of the current system, who took to the streets to protest against war and injustice ? and who want their country back.
